The harm knowledge used by fire investigators in origin willpower commences with the power with the investigator to observe varying damage along surfaces of contents, partitions, ceiling, ground and structural users. The fire investigator’s observations are simply just assessing the different DOFD. Identification of various DOFD through the compartment serves as The premise for interpretation through website the investigator. Fire investigation textbooks, guides and research describe using lines or regions of demarcation in evaluating harm. The areas of injury and boundaries of Individuals locations are often often called spots and lines of demarcation.

Kirk was the following to put ahead a normal system regarding how to establish the world of origin based upon problems. The main focus of his approach was much like the Other people in describing that the area of origin will be Positioned at the greatest space of injury along with the investigators must center on determining the minimal burn destruction regions and making use of conical designs. He encouraged investigators to center on small burns, due to the fact as he states “any low place in a melt away must be investigated as being a probable origin” (Kirk 1969). Nonetheless, Kirk also identifies many of the “very common complications” which will arise, which will “distract the investigator from following the fire sample back to its point of origin” (Kirk 1969).

The conical fire sample principle advanced into a much more systematized manner by the Kennedys (Kennedy and Kennedy 1985). The procedure was called the truncated cone system, which described the fire plume as a three-dimensional cone that may be Slice or truncated by the different two-dimensional horizontal and vertical obstructions (i.
